Официальное название

Open Access Protocol of Targeted Radiotherapy With I-metaiodobenzylguanidine (I-MIBG) in Patients With Resistant Neuroblastoma or Malignant Chromaffin Cell Tumors

Обзор

The purpose of this research study is to find how active and safe 131 I-MIBG is in patients with resistant neuroblastoma, malignant pheochromocytoma and malignant paraganglioma.

Вмешательства

  • Препарат iobenguane I 131
    A single dose of iodine I 131 metaiodobenzylguanidine (\^131I-MIBG) IV over 30 minutes to 4 hours or for 15 minutes for smaller patients on day 0. Patients undergo radiation dosimetry following the first dose of \^131I-MIBG to determine if a second dose can be safely administered. Some patients may receive a second dose of iodine I 131 metaiodobenzylguanidine (\^131I-MIBG) 6-8 weeks after the first dose. Критерии участия

Inclusion criteria for NB:

  • Patients must have the diagnosis of NB in accordance with the International Criteria, i.e., either histopathology (confirmed by the MSKCC Department of Pathology) or BM involvement plus elevated urinary catecholamines.
  • Must have a history of tumor progression or recurrence or failure to achieve complete response with standard therapy.
  • Patients must have MIBG-avid NB and evaluable disease on MIBG scan at time of enrollment on protocol
  • Prior Therapy: At least 2 weeks should have elapsed since any biologic therapy. Three weeks should have elapsed since last dose of chemotherapy.
  • Age >1 year
  • Determination that radiation safety restrictions during therapy period can be implemented.
  • Stem cells: Patients for high does must have an autologous hematopoietic stem cell product cryopreserved and available for re-infusion after MIBG treatment. Patients for low dose do not require cryopreserved autologous hematopoietic stem cell product available. The minimum dose for peripheral blood stem cells is 2 X106 CD34+ cells/kg.
  • Minimum life expectancy of eight weeks
  • Signed informed consent indicating awareness of the investigational nature of this program.

Inclusion criteria for malignant CCT:

  • Patients must have the diagnosis of malignant CCT i.e. malignant pheochromocytoma or malignant paraganglioma
  • Patients must have MIBG-avid malignant CCT and evaluable disease on MIBG scan at time of enrollment on protocol
  • Prior Therapy: At least 2 weeks should have elapsed since any biologic therapy. Three weeks should have elapsed since last dose of chemotherapy.
  • Age between 1 and 21 years and able to cooperate with radiation safety restrictions during therapy period
  • Stem cells: Patients must have an autologous hematopoietic stem cell product cryopreserved and available for re-infusion after MIBG treatment. The minimum dose for peripheral blood stem cells is 2 X106 CD34+ cells/kg.
  • Minimum life expectancy of eight weeks.
  • Signed informed consent indicating awareness of the investigational nature of this program.

Критерии исключения

  • Severe major organ toxicity. Specifically, renal, cardiac, hepatic, pulmonary, gastrointestinal and neurologic toxicity should all be grade 2 or less. A grade 3 hearing deficit is acceptable.
  • Active serious infections not controlled by antibiotics.
  • Pregnant women are excluded for fear of danger to the fetus. Therefore negative pregnancy test is required for all women of child-bearing age, and appropriate contraception is used during the study period.
  • Inability or unwillingness to comply with radiation safety procedures or protocol requirements.
